Overview

The btuB riboswitch is a cis-regulatory RNA element located in the 5' untranslated region (UTR) of the btuB mRNA, primarily characterized in Escherichia coli and other Gram-negative bacteria (Nahvi et al., 2002). It serves as a high-affinity sensor for adenosylcobalamin (AdoCbl), a coenzyme form of vitamin B12, regulating the expression of the btuB gene which encodes an outer membrane cobalamin transporter (Cadreux et al., 2022). Upon binding AdoCbl, the riboswitch undergoes a structural rearrangement that sequesters the Shine-Dalgarno sequence, thereby inhibiting translation initiation through an "off-switch" mechanism (Nahvi et al., 2004). This regulatory process is vital for maintaining cellular homeostasis of vitamin B12 and preventing the energetic cost of unnecessary transporter synthesis. Because riboswitches are highly specific to bacteria and regulate essential metabolic pathways, they are increasingly investigated as targets for novel antimicrobial agents, such as cobalamin analogs that can constitutively trigger gene repression (Blount and Breaker, 2006).

Mechanism of action

Ligand binding to the aptamer domain induces a conformational change in the expression platform, sequestering the ribosome binding site to inhibit translation (Nahvi et al., 2004).
